Both Ios and Valletta offer a variety of museums and places of interest, but Valletta generally has more to choose from.
The museums, monuments, and landmarks in Valletta are among the most recognizable in the world. With its rich culture and compact old town, there are countless museums, sights, and monuments that are worth visiting. Some options include Saint John's Co-Cathedral, the Grandmaster's Palace and Armory, the National Museum of Archaeology, Manoel Theater, and the Upper Barrakka Gardens.
If you're looking for an educational opportunity, there are a decent number of museums and historical sights around Ios. If you can pull yourself away from the beaches or parties, there are a number of archaeological and historic sights around the island. Churches like Panayia Gremiotissa Church and Evangelisimos Cathedral are worth visiting. Other attractions include Odysseas Elytis Theatre, Homer’s Tomb, and Skarkos Hill.
Both Ios and Valletta offer good local cuisine and restaurants.
Eating is part of the travel experience when you visit Ios. Most of the island's restaurants are found in the port area or in the town of Chora, but you'll also find several options near Mylopotas Beach. Most restaurants offer typical Greek dishes, but they often have a local twist. You'll often find local cheeses or a slightly different take on an old favorite. Popular ingredients include cheese, yogurt, fish, olives, honey, olive oil, and grains. Common meats include lamb, beef, and even rabbit, but seafood is obviously popular as well.
Valletta has long been recognized as a culinary destination with great restaurants. The town's culinary scene has a long history with many traditional flavors. You really must experience a meal in one of the traditional stone cellar restaurants, which often serve local meze. Head to Republic Street for a stretch of longstanding restaurants in town. Local dishes include stuffat tal-fenek (rabbit stew), bragioli (rolled meat covered in sauce), and lampuki pie (fish pie).
With more options to choose from, you'll find a more vibrant nightlife in Ios.
Ios is a party destination, and you'll find plenty of activity all night long. This is one of the quintessential party islands in Greece. Many young backpackers come here just to party, particularly during the summer months. You'll find many parties start around midnight or later and carry on well into the morning. Most of the clubs and bars are around the main square and nearby streets in Chora, but there are also clubs spread throughout the town. Outside of town, Mylopotas Beach is another popular party area.
With a handful of venues, visitors can find a fairly lively vibe in Valletta. It wasn't long ago that the town went quiet in the evenings, but recent years have brought a surge in bars and clubs around town. You'll find the liveliest nightlife in areas around Strait Street and the Valletta Waterfront. If you're looking for a true clubbing scene, you'll want to head north out of town to Paceville.
Most people pick Ios for its beaches over Valletta.
Travelers come from around the world to visit the beaches in Ios. The island has beautiful sandy beaches that range from family-friendly to party hard. There are popular and more developed beaches near Chora like Koumbara and Mylopotas as well as more relaxing beaches a little more removed like Kalamos and Manganari. Because of their striking beauty, the beaches around the island have been featured in a few films.
The beach in Valletta is worth checking out. There aren't any beaches in town, but if you head north to St. George’s Bay you'll find some nice beaches with a variety of resorts to choose from.
Both Ios and Valletta are good shopping destinations.
Ios offers some nice shopping areas. There are a number of local souvenirs that you can pick up. Many visitors prefer to take home unique items such as a tin of olives or olive oil. Jewelry, honey, and local ceramics also make good gifts.
Many visitors explore the shopping areas in Valletta. For the best shopping head to Republic Street and Merchants Street where you'll find craft shops, boutiques, and other local souvenirs. Many visitors enjoy picking up blown glass, a locally made miniature, or cactus liquor. Lace is also a common local item that you'll find around town.

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.
The average daily cost (per person) in Ios is €91, while the average daily cost in Valletta is €143.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ment.
